
The bloodshed and loss of life is devastating, the lack of balance in reporting the conflict we watch unfold is predictable and complicit.
Source: Israeli forces have killed 2400 Palestinian children since year 2000 – Pearls and Irritations

The bloodshed and loss of life is devastating, the lack of balance in reporting the conflict we watch unfold is predictable and complicit.
Source: Israeli forces have killed 2400 Palestinian children since year 2000 – Pearls and Irritations